mac系统下安装和启动nginx

1.在线安装

localhost:nginx-1.17.1 mhx$ sudo brew install nginx

2.查看是否安装成功

localhost:nginx-1.17.1 mhx$ nginx -v

nginx version: nginx/1.17.1

3.启动

localhost:nginx mhx$ sudo nginx

4.查看是否启动成功

在浏览器中访问 http://localhost:8080,如果出现Nginx界面,则说明启动成功.
备注:端口号是在配置文件 nginx.conf 里面配置的,默认端口是 8080 ,配置文件的位置/usr/local/etc/nginx/nginx.conf

5.关闭

localhost:nginx mhx$ sudo nginx -s stop

6.重新加载

localhost:nginx mhx$ sudo nginx -s reload

7.max系统局域网访问不了问题,解决方法

1)nginx.conf最开头加上以下一行

user root owner;

2)设置权限

sudo chown root:wheel /usr/local/Cellar/nginx/1.17.1/bin/nginx

sudo chmod u+s /usr/local/Cellar/nginx/1.17.1/bin/nginx

3)重新启动

localhost:nginx mhx$ sudo nginx

原文地址:https://www.cnblogs.com/code4app/p/11165207.html